Pollokshaws West might be a smaller station, but it ensures that the essentials are covered. While there isn't a staffed 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ines, making it easy to purchase and collect tickets for your journey. For commuters with accessibility needs, the machines are adapted accordingly with features such as induction loops installed for sound enhancement.
There's no step-free access to platforms, as both require the use of stairs, categorizing Pollokshaws West as a Category C station, which could be a consideration for those with mobility concerns. Despite the lack of extensive support services, customer assistance is available through strategically placed help points, ensuring passengers can get the support they need. However, do plan ahead as there's no dedicated staff to assist at this station.
Commuters will find it easy to switch between train and bus services as the station connects conveniently with local bus routes. There are dedicated rail replacement bus services for a seamless transition during times when the rail service might face interruptions. For an exact pickup location, apps like What3Words can guide you, ensuring no hassle in finding the bus stop near Pollokshaws West.
Although there is no direct taxi service at the station, you can access information about local taxis through TrainTaxi. Due to the lack of car parking facilities, travelers are encouraged to use buses or other modes of public transport when commuting to and from the station.

Huncoat station provides essential services for a convenient travel experience. Despite a lack of a staffed ticket office, you'll find ticket machines on-site, allowing you to collect pre-booked tickets with ease. Located on Platform 1, these machines are accessible for all passengers, ensuring smooth travel for everyone, including those with mobility challenges. While the station lacks facilities like waiting rooms or restrooms, it’s heartening to know that seating areas are available for passengers to use while waiting for their trains.
Accessibility is considered, though Huncoat offers only partial step-free access, making it essential for those with specific requirements to check ahead. With no dedicated staff presence, assistance at the station is provided by the train's conductor, and passengers can request help via platforms. For those needing advance support, remembering the Passenger Assist service is invaluable.
If you’re planning onward travel from Huncoat, options are available to integrate your rail journey smoothly with other transport modes. For occasional disruptions, a rail replacement bus service can be caught from Station Road, conveniently positioned near local landmarks. However, the station doesn't house taxi services directly, yet with modern conveniences, you can easily book a ride through online platforms such as Northern Railway’s [Cab4You](https://www.north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you).
While bicycle hire is not currently available, travelers can benefit from local bus services. For up-to-date bus schedules and more information, Busline at 0871 200 2233 could be your go-to contact for seamless planning of your travels.
